问题描述
- 求教一个shell调用存储过程的问题
-
今天我用一个shell去调用存储过程,但是跑到一半我把shell给改了,请问这样做会使原来的存储过程中断么?非常急,求大神解答
解决方案
存储过程使用事务,如果执行失败回滚。具体参考:http://www.cnblogs.com/rascallysnake/archive/2010/05/17/1737298.html
解决方案二:
怕不全就把上次插入的数据回退过去,重新插入就加上事物,如果失败就自动回滚。
解决方案三:
本人第一次接触shell,我改错shell之后发现数据库中原来的shell中存储过程所对应的表确实被插入了数据,但我怕插入的数据不全,所以还请各位大神帮助啊
解决方案四:
用数据库把数据回退回去
时间: 2024-08-23 04:45:28